project-settings

Overview

This skill documents how to use the project.updateSettings command to modify the global settings of the project: canvas dimensions, background color, and FPS. All values are merged into the existing settings, so you only need to include the fields you want to change.

Instructions

When the user asks to change the canvas size, aspect ratio, background color, or frame rate, output a step with type: "command" using project.updateSettings.


1. Changing Aspect Ratio / Canvas Size

Use the standard presets below. Always set both width and height together.

Presets

Name Ratio Width Height Use case
Vertical / Portrait 9:16 1080 1920 TikTok, Reels, Shorts
Horizontal / Landscape 16:9 1920 1080 YouTube, presentations
Square 1:1 1080 1080 Instagram feed, profile
Portrait (Instagram) 4:5 1080 1350 Instagram portrait feed
Classic TV 4:3 1440 1080 Legacy, classic look
Cinescope 21:9 2560 1080 Ultra-wide cinematic

2. Changing Background Color

backgroundColor is a hex color string. It sets the canvas background behind all clips.

3. Changing Frame Rate

fps controls how many frames per second the project renders. Standard values are 24, 25, 30, 60.

4. Combining Multiple Settings in One Step

You can change multiple settings in a single command. Only include the fields you want to change.

Example: Switch to vertical 9:16 with a black background

{
  "type": "command",
  "description": "Switch to vertical 9:16 with black background",
  "command": {
    "type": "project.updateSettings",
    "payload": {
      "width": 1080,
      "height": 1920,
      "backgroundColor": "#000000"
    }
  }
}

5. Settings Reference

Field Type Description
width number Canvas width in pixels
height number Canvas height in pixels
backgroundColor string Hex color, e.g. "#000000"
fps number Frames per second (e.g. 24, 30, 60)
duration number Total project duration in microseconds (usually managed automatically)

⚠️ Do not set duration manually unless explicitly asked. It is recalculated automatically from clip timings.


When to use

  • User says "make it vertical", "switch to 9:16", "TikTok format", "Reels format" → set width: 1080, height: 1920
  • User says "make it horizontal", "YouTube format", "widescreen" → set width: 1920, height: 1080
  • User says "make it square", "Instagram square" → set width: 1080, height: 1080
  • User says "change background color to X", "set background to X", "background should be X" → set backgroundColor
  • User says "change FPS", "set frame rate" → set fps
